About Koojan Downs Feeding Facility:
Koojan Downs feeding facility is located 30kms from Moora and 160kms north of Perth. Koojan Downs is part of the integrated beef supply chain for Harvest Road. This integrated beef supply chain ranges from north to southwest of Western Australia and is based on best-practice ecological planning and animal welfare management.

About the business: Thomas Foods International Feedlot is a key operation in growing, supplying, and distributing premium meat to the world and forms part of the agricultural division of Thomas Foods International, one of Australia’s largest family-owned businesses since 1988. The Feedlot with a 27,000 standard cattle unit capacity is located in Tintinara, South Australia, and is a key partner of the new Murray Bridge Processing Plant.

About the role: The Livestock Hand (Pen Rider) are responsible for maintaining the health, welfare, and overall care of livestock, in strict adherence to both internal guidelines and external regulations. Duties of pen riders include and will require you to have some experience in: Horse-based and general livestock husbandry tasks; Monitoring cattle health on horseback; Drafting and moving cattle on horseback; Administration of animal health products; Receiving, drafting, processing, and moving of cattle daily; Must have a current drivers licence. Pen Riders will ideally supply 2 suitable working horses and tack to be considered for the position which attracts a generous fortnightly horse allowance along with shoeing, feed, vaccinations, regular horsemanship training and individual paddocks for your horses.

Teys Australia is an innovative Australian food business with home grown pride and global reach. Drawing on more than 70 years’ experience in the beef industry, our team of over 4,500 focus their energy and expertise on delivering value to our communities, customers and consumers.

Charlton Feedlot is located near Charlton in north-west Victoria just 2 1/2 hours from Melbourne. This very modern 22,000 head facility serves a key role in the Teys Australia supply chain producing quality beef for the domestic and short-fed export markets.

About the Role:

We are looking for an experienced Feedmill Supervisor to join our team on a permanent full-time basis.

Leading a team of up to 8 people, the successful applicant will be responsible for overseeing the hands-on day to day milling & feeding operations at the feedlot. The modern steam flaking mill is state of the art and can process up to 200 tonne of grain per day.

The feeding system utilises the latest Digistar technology and delivery is carried out using Rotomix feedtrucks.
